Texas A&M’s 2025 tight end rotation will feature Amari Niblack, a former Alabama and Texas player known for his receiving skills, who aims to thrive in OC Collin Klein’s system after a lackluster 2024 season. Head coach Mike Elko emphasized Niblack’s hybrid potential, suggesting he will be better utilized as a receiver, contrasting with his previous role as a blocking tight end.
